Today was another really good day.  We had our water main and septic area dug and he'll finish up tomorrow if it doesn't rain.  It was beautiful and not to hot.  I keep wondering when the hot weather is going to kick in.  So far it's been perfect.  The lady from the extension office came out to talk to me about having a berry farm and she said to get the soil tested before anything else.  Also that we have a great piece of land without any problem areas and that we could grow anything on it except probably blueberries.  Go figure.  Oh well we'll wait till we get the soil samples back and go from there.  I wanted to have a variety of berries anyway not just blueberries.  She said it would probably be a fight to keep the soil acidic enough for blueberries.  We have so much natural calcium in our soil that it tends to be alkaline.  Take care
